Novel Summary (from Wikipedia): Sixteen-year-old Shinkurou Kurenai, a specialist in settling squabbles between people, is one day approached by his employer with the daughter of a powerful plutocratic family asking him to be her bodyguard.




After a six year gap and a great anime adaptation by Brain’s Base, volume five of Kurenai has finally been released, so what better time to take on this action-packed series as our new project?
